A Message From Our Chef

The dedicated kitchen staff of the Napa Valley Wine Train believes wholeheartedly that “anyone can cook.” However, being able to see the entire picture is what makes a great chef. The entire picture you ask? Let me explain. We

  • Use fresh local produce
  • Use natural hydroponic vegetables and lettuces
  • Use fresh native California farm raised fish and shell fish
  • Use fresh, line-caught fish
  • Use humanely raised meats
  • Do not use chemically enhanced products
  • Do not use meats enhanced with growth hormones

Additionally, by taking an aggressive approach, the Napa Valley Wine Train is a one of the Valley’s leaders in recycling. Not only does recycling save landfill space, it also saves energy and water, conserves natural resources, and reduces pollution.

Doing these things, along with serving safe, beautiful, appetizing gourmet meals is what makes the Napa Valley Wine Train kitchen extraordinary and without equal.

The Napa Valley Wine Train is one of the most unique restaurants that you will ever visit. Our chefs have practiced for years to be able to present a fabulous gourmet meal, the equal of any at Napa's other great restaurants, on a moving train. Just like at other fine dinning establishments, when you are a a guest on the Napa Valley Wine Train you order off a menu (or choose the special), and we cook your food only after we know exactly how you like it.

We actually have three kitchens on board the Napa Valley Wine Train, and we love it when guests come to see us at work. We have even installed windows on our main kitchen so that guests can watch the grill fire from 3 feet away! When you come on the train be sure to ask your server when the best time to visit the kitchen would be, then come and see how we do it in person!
